Perception Characteristics for Visually Impaired and Blind People for Text-reading Voice
Kazuo Kamata, Yoshiteru Matsumoto (Utsunomiya Univ.), Teruyoshi Fujinuma (ISTAL), Shunichi Yonemura (NTT) WIT2011-3
Abstract (in Japanese) (See Japanese page) 
(in English) Visually impaired and blind people utilise aural messages as alternative ones for usual visual materials. In this report, perception experiment with visually impaired and blind people was conducted to investigate the relationship with features of text-reading voices (synthetic voices), content of text, and individual user characteristics. Subjects who use screen reader in everyday life prefer typical synthetic voice compared to those who do not use PCs. We point out certain issues for improving use situation of this kind of synthetic voice service for visually impaired and blind people.
